Self-spreading prompts can jump between AI agents through shared state files

Researchers, including teams at Anthropic and EPFL, demonstrated that self-propagating instructions can spread from one AI agent to another through the editable prompt and state files that autonomous agent harnesses use to carry context between sessions. In simulated multi-agent coding setups, a payload written into a shared file could infect the next agent that read it. The researchers call the risk real but currently limited, noting there is no sign of it spreading in the wild and that compromising one agent usually already grants machine access. Encouragingly, adding a single short warning paragraph to an agent's system prompt cut propagation to nearly zero across the payloads they tested.

Check
If you run autonomous or multi-agent setups, treat their persistent prompt and state files as an integrity boundary, and review what those files contain and which agents can write to them.
Affected
Autonomous and multi-agent systems that share editable prompt or state files between agents or sessions; a malicious instruction written into such a file can propagate to other agents that read it.
Fix
Control and review writes to shared agent state, add a system-prompt warning that cut propagation to near zero in testing, isolate agents and their files, and monitor state files for unexpected instructions.

New 'TCLBanker' Android malware spreads itself by hijacking WhatsApp and Outlook to message every contact in the victim's address book

Researchers disclosed TCLBANKER, an Android banking trojan that adds worm-style self-propagation: once installed, it abuses Accessibility Services to read the victim's WhatsApp and Outlook contact lists and then send malicious download links to every contact as if from the victim. The malware targets banking and crypto-wallet apps with overlay screens that capture credentials, plus SMS-interception modules that grab one-time passcodes. Self-spreading via the victim's own messaging history defeats traditional URL-reputation controls. The campaign concentrates in Brazil, Spain, and Italy banking apps initially. Operators are renting access on Telegram for $1,500-3,000/month.

Check
Brief staff who manage Android devices that any 'app download' link sent through WhatsApp or Outlook from a known contact during business hours should be verified out-of-band before clicking. Review unfamiliar Android apps requesting Accessibility Services.
Affected
Android users in Brazil, Spain, and Italy initially - but worm-style spread will broaden the geography rapidly. Acute risk: anyone whose phone has Accessibility Services enabled for any third-party app. Banking and cryptocurrency app users face credential theft via overlay attacks. Contact networks of infected users get the lures next.
Fix
On managed Android devices: enforce MDM policies that block sideloading and require approval for any app requesting Accessibility Services. Disable Accessibility Services for apps that don't genuinely need it. Brief staff on the worm-spread pattern: contacts sending links to download apps is a hostile signal regardless of who the sender is.
